St Alban's (ward) displays distinctive ethnic group characteristics:

The main ethnic group is White British, representing 54% of the population. On average, 37% of the population in London belong to the White British ethnic group.

The following ethnic groups have proportions higher than average for the London:

  • White British comprise 54%, while average for London is 37%

Conversely, the following ethnic groups have a proportion lower than the average for London:

  • Indian comprise 3%, while average for London is 7%
  • Other comprise 2.4%, while average for London is 5%

Data source: Office for National Statistics

Census 2021

St Alban's (ward) displays distinctive religion characteristics:

The main religion is Christian, representing 46% of the population. On average, 41% of the population in London belong to the Christian religion.

The following religions have proportions higher than average for the London:

  • No Religion comprise 32%, while average for London is 27%

Conversely, the following religions have a proportion lower than the average for London:

  • Hindu comprise 2.2%, while average for London is 5%
  • Muslim comprise 10%, while average for London is 15%

St Alban's (ward) displays distinctive household type characteristics:

The main household type is Families with young children, representing 32% of the population. On average, 27% of the population in London belong to the Families with young children household type.

The following household types have proportions higher than average for the London:

  • Families with young children comprise 32%, while average for London is 27%

Conversely, the following household types have a proportion lower than the average for London:

  • Extended families or unrelated people comprise 9%, while average for London is 13%
